如何在GitHub上上传自己的网页

引言

在当今数字化的时代,个人网页不仅能展示个人技能与项目经验,也为开发者提供了一个良好的展示平台。很多开发者选择使用GitHub来托管他们的网页,而最常见的方法之一便是通过GitHub Pages。本文将详细介绍如何在GitHub上上传自己的网页,并回答一些常见问题。

什么是GitHub Pages?

GitHub Pages是一个免费的静态网页托管服务,允许用户直接从GitHub的代码仓库中生成网站。通过GitHub Pages,用户可以将项目文档、个人博客或者任何静态网页轻松发布到网上。

GitHub Pages的优点

  • 免费托管:用户可以不花费任何费用就将自己的网页托管在GitHub上。
  • 简易设置:创建和配置GitHub Pages相对简单,只需几步操作即可完成。
  • 版本控制:利用GitHub的版本控制功能,用户可以轻松管理网页的不同版本。
  • 自定义域名:用户可以绑定自己的域名,提升网站的专业性。

如何创建自己的网页并上传到GitHub?

第一步:注册GitHub账户

如果你还没有GitHub账户,首先需要访问GitHub官方网站进行注册。注册后,你将拥有一个全新的代码仓库。

第二步:创建新的代码仓库

  1. 登录到你的GitHub账户。
  2. 点击页面右上角的“+”号,选择“New repository”。
  3. 填写仓库名称,选择“Public”或“Private”。
  4. 点击“Create repository”。

第三步:准备网页文件

在本地计算机上创建一个文件夹,放置你想要上传的网页文件。这些文件通常包括:

  • index.html:网页的主要HTML文件。
  • 相关的CSS文件。
  • 图片文件等。

第四步:上传文件到GitHub

  1. 打开你刚创建的仓库页面。
  2. 点击“Upload files”按钮,选择你刚才准备的网页文件。
  3. 完成后,点击“Commit changes”提交更改。

第五步:启用GitHub Pages

  1. 在仓库主页,点击“Settings”标签。
  2. 向下滚动至“GitHub Pages”部分。
  3. 在“Source”下拉菜单中,选择“main branch”或“master branch”,然后点击“Save”。
  4. 页面刷新后,将看到你的网站链接。

上传后的检查

上传并启用GitHub Pages后,访问你的网页链接以确保一切正常运行。如果有任何问题,可以检查HTML和CSS文件,确保路径和文件名的正确性。

FAQ – 常见问题解答

1. GitHub能上传动态网页吗?

GitHub Pages主要用于托管静态网页,因此不能直接上传和运行动态网页(如PHP或Node.js)。如果你需要动态功能,可以考虑使用其他服务器。

2. 是否可以使用自定义域名?

是的,你可以通过设置DNS记录,将你的自定义域名指向GitHub Pages。在设置中找到“Custom domain”部分,并按照说明进行配置。

3. GitHub Pages支持哪些文件类型?

GitHub Pages支持静态文件,如HTML、CSS、JavaScript、图像文件(如PNG、JPG、GIF)等。

4. 上传文件大小有限制吗?

是的,GitHub对每个仓库的大小限制为1GB,单个文件大小限制为100MB。因此在上传时需注意文件的大小。

5. 如何更新我的网页?

只需在本地计算机上更新相应的文件,然后按照上传文件的步骤重新上传并提交即可。新的更改将自动反映在你的网页上。

结论

使用GitHub上传网页非常简单,通过GitHub Pages可以快速将你的作品展示给世界。无论是个人项目、学习资料还是专业博客,GitHub都是一个值得信赖的平台。如果你对网页开发感兴趣,不妨尝试一下上传自己的网页到GitHub上。

正文完